Umsetzungsplan

  1. Validate the Bern neighborhood catchment and set a tight radius delivery/pickup promise within your kitchen capacity
  2. Build a menu optimized for high-margin staples (signature pizzas, value combos) and limit SKUs to protect speed and consistency
  3. Run pre-opening and first-90-day promotions tied to local events and student/office clusters to stabilize daily covers
  4. Implement cost controls: portioning, vendor price checks, and weekly waste tracking to protect the upper end of the $3,390–$12,597 profit band
  5. Differentiate with branding and online discoverability (Google Business Profile, local SEO pages, and review acquisition plan)
  6. Monitor unit economics monthly (revenue per cover, food cost %, labor %, contribution margin) to stay within the 9–33 month break-even window
